| welcome always nice to have new people remmber to learn as much as you can about the Atkins diet all to often people try it with out knowing much about it and then feel tired and crappy and then think the diet is bad xD it takes your bodys metabolism a while to switch from a glucose burning metabolism to a natural fat burning metabolism so thats why theres the induction flu people call it at the start of the diet so it can take 14 days to get over it but other ppl are faster and take only like 7 days but some people are slow and take 3 weeks heres some tips to help speed up the metabolism change so you start feeling great eat around 65-75% fat 20-30% protein 5% carbs (20 net carbs) eating high fat low carb helps switch the body to a fat burning metabolism also remmber to drink extra extra water when starting the diet and loseing weight |
